What is Double Glazing?
Double glazing is a kind of insulation that includes 2 panes of glass separated by a space, usually filled with air or inert gas. This configuration serves a main purpose: to decrease heat transfer between the interior and exterior of a building. As a result, double-glazed windows assist keep heat during winter season and keep areas cooler throughout summer.

Glass Types
The efficiency of double glazing is mainly influenced by the kind of glass used. Below are the typical types of glass used in double glazing:
Glass TypeDescriptionAdvantagesDrawbacksFloat GlassBasic glass, normally utilized in standard applications.AffordableLess insulation compared to Low-E glass.Low-Emissivity (Low-E)Glass coated with a thin metallic layer to reflect heat.Excellent insulation, protects natural light.Higher initial cost.Tempered GlassHeat-treated glass that is stronger and more secure.More durable, resistant to effect.Can be more costly due to processing.Laminated GlassGlass layers bonded with a plastic interlayer.Deals security and UV security.Heavier and more costly alternatives.2. Spacer Bars
Spacer bars are the products that separate the two panes of glass in a double-glazed system. Various products can be used for this function:
Spacer Bar MaterialDescriptionAdvantagesDownsidesAluminiumLightweight and stiff however conductive.Long lasting and cost-efficient.Can cause condensation due to heat transfer.PVC-UA plastic alternative, less conductive compared to aluminum.Good thermal performance.May not be as long lasting as aluminum.Warm Edge TechnologyTypically consists of a composite material.Minimizes thermal bridging, enhancing effectiveness.Normally more costly.3. Gas Fills
The space in between the panes of glass can be filled with air or specific gases to improve insulation.

Q: How long do double-glazed windows last?

A: Typically, double-glazed windows can last anywhere from 20 to 35 years, depending upon the quality double glazing of materials and installation.

Q: Can I change simply one pane of a double-glazed unit?

A: It is generally recommended to change the whole double-glazed system for ideal performance, as replacing only one pane can result in mismatching insulation properties.

Q: Are double-glazed systems more costly than single glazing?

A: Yes, double glazing prices-glazed units typically have a higher upfront expense due to innovative materials and construction, but they typically pay for themselves through energy savings.

Q: Will double glazing decrease sound pollution?

A: Yes, double-glazing effectively reduces outdoors noise, making your living environment more tranquil.
